What is Butyl Tape?
Butyl tape is a type of adhesive tape that's made from butyl rubber. It's known for its incredible waterproof properties and strong adhesive power. Unlike other tapes that might peel off or lose their grip over time, butyl tape stays put, providing a long-lasting seal that keeps water out for good. Whether you're sealing windows, doors, or even roofs, butyl tape is up to the task.

Sealing Made Easy
One of the best things about butyl tape is how easy it is to use. You don't need any special tools or skills to apply it. Simply cut the tape to the desired length, peel off the backing, and stick it in place. It adheres quickly and firmly, creating a tight seal that won't let water through. Plus, it's flexible, so it can conform to irregular surfaces and angles, making it ideal for a wide range of applications.
